1. Bono spends most of his time at the tip of the heart (opposite of the actual stage
2. People started lining up for the show here in Austin 18 hours ahead of time. And no, that wasn't for tickets... that was to get in the door, they already had tickets.
3. Yes, they allowed cameras... at least here in Austin. I wish I would have known that because I had a good vantage point of the whole show.
there really isn't a bad spot for the show.... though if you can't get to the tip of the heart... try to get along the edge of the heart somewhere... Bono walks around it many many times. But the tip of is is best (edge even comes out and jams with bono at the tip)

I showed up at 9:00 am and was number 140 out of 300 that get let into the heart in Washington DC.
Inside the heart was great because there is a great deal of room and because the band plays all around you people don't try to squeeze on top of each other. I was probably about 2 rows back in front of the Edge.
Amazing show by the way
